# ASN.1 OBJECT IDENTIFIER Decoding Issue:
#
# In ASN.1 BER/DER encoding, the first two arcs of an OBJECT IDENTIFIER are
# combined into a single value: (40 * arc0) + arc1. This is encoded as a base-128
# variable-length quantity (and commonly known as VLQ or base-128 encoding)
# as specified in ITU-T X.690 §8.19, it can span multiple bytes if
# the value is large.
#
# For arc0 = 0 or 1, arc1 must be in [0, 39]. For arc0 = 2, arc1 can be any non-negative integer.
# All subsequent arcs (arc2, arc3, ...) are each encoded as a separate base-128 VLQ.
#
# The decoding bug occurs when the decoder does not properly split the first
# subidentifier for arc0 = 2 and arc1 >= 40. Instead of decoding:
# - arc0 = 2
# - arc1 = (first_subidentifier - 80)
# it may incorrectly interpret the first_subidentifier as arc0 = (first_subidentifier // 40),
# arc1 = (first_subidentifier % 40), which is only valid for arc1 < 40.
#
# This patch handles it properly for all valid OBJECT IDENTIFIERs
# with large second arcs, by applying the ASN.1 rules:
# - if first_subidentifier < 40: arc0 = 0, arc1 = first_subidentifier
# - elif first_subidentifier < 80: arc0 = 1, arc1 = first_subidentifier - 40
# - else: arc0 = 2, arc1 = first_subidentifier - 80
#
# This problem is not uncommon, see for example https://github.com/randombit/botan/issues/4023
